Pearl Harbor fleet undergoing changes
|
|
|
|
|
HONOLULU (AP) — The Pearl Harbor fleet is undergoing some changes.
The Honolulu Star-Advertiser says at least three surface ships are being retired.
Other changes are in works. A new destroyer will be named after a Hawaii-based SEAL commando. A destroyer from San Diego will be traded for one here, and more of the Navy's latest-generation Virginia-class attack subs will be sent to Hawaii.
Officials say the 11-ship surface fleet will shrink, while the 19-sub fleet will grow.
Bruce Smith, a retired Navy captain and former chief of staff for the U.S. Pacific Fleet submarine force, says the changes are a sign of the new national defense policy emphasizing Asia and the Pacific being put into action.
